AI can understand brain signals linked to the sensory and motor processes involved in speech. In this Q&A, Edward Chang, MD, the chair and professor of neurosurgery at UCSF joins JAMA's Editor in Chief Kirsten Bibbins-Domingo, PhD, MD, MAS, to discuss how AI has the potential to facilitate communication and how close AI development is to being able to translate human emotion.
